HTTP + XML
The following are sample HTTP requests and responses.
The placeholders shown need to be replaced with actual values.
POST /xml/reply/VinDecodeStylesRequest HTTP/1.1
Host: api.homenetiol.com
Content-Type: application/xml
Content-Length: length
<VinDecodeStylesR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/HNI.InventoryOnline.WebIOL.WebApi.MessageHandlers.Mobile">
<Vin xmlns="http://schemas.datacontract.org/2004/07/HNI.InventoryOnline.WebIOL.WebApi.Common.Messages.Mobile">String</Vin>
</VinDecodeStylesRequest>
HTTP/1.1 200 OK
Content-Type: application/xml
Content-Length: length
<VinDecodeStylesResponse x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/HNI.InventoryOnline.WebIOL.WebApi.Common.Messages.Mobile">
<Styles>
<Style>
<DriveTrain>String</DriveTrain>
<EngineAspiration>String</EngineAspiration>
<EngineBlockType>String</EngineBlockType>
<EngineCylinders>String</EngineCylinders>
<EngineDescription>String</EngineDescription>
<EngineDisplacement>String</EngineDisplacement>
<EpaCityRating>String</EpaCityRating>
<EpaHighwayRating>String</EpaHighwayRating>
<ExteriorColors>
<VehicleColor>
<Code>String</Code>
<Generic>String</Generic>
<HexCode>String</HexCode>
<Name>String</Name>
</VehicleColor>
</ExteriorColors>
<FuelType>String</FuelType>
<HomeNetStyleCode>String</HomeNetStyleCode>
<InteriorColors>
<VehicleColor>
<Code>String</Code>
<Generic>String</Generic>
<HexCode>String</HexCode>
<Name>String</Name>
</VehicleColor>
</InteriorColors>
<Make>String</Make>
<Model>String</Model>
<StyleID>String</StyleID>
<StyleNameWithoutTrim>String</StyleNameWithoutTrim>
<TransmissionDescription>String</TransmissionDescription>
<TransmissionSpeed>String</TransmissionSpeed>
<TransmissionType>String</TransmissionType>
<Trim>String</Trim>
<VIN>String</VIN>
<VINPattern>String</VINPattern>
<Year>String</Year>
</Style>
</Styles>
</VinDecodeStylesResponse>